Check for Proper Licensing and Insurance
One of the most important steps in choosing any electrician is verifying their credentials. Always ensure they have valid licensing issued by recognized regulatory bodies. This ensures they have the training and legal standing to perform electrical work in Peterborough. Also, confirm they carry public liability insurance and, if necessary, worker’s compensation coverage. Adequate insurance protects you from unforeseen costs if accidents happen on your property.
Ask About Experience and Qualifications
Electricians often have different areas of expertise: residential wiring, industrial electrical systems, or commercial installations. When interviewing a potential electrician, ask about their background:
- How many years have they been in the industry?
- What types of projects do they work on most frequently?
- Can they provide references or testimonials from past clients?
An electrician with a solid track record in the specific services you need will be more reliable and efficient.
Read Reviews and Get Referrals
In the digital age, online reviews can be extremely helpful. Search for testimonials on Google and local business directories for local electricians in Peterborough. Keep an eye on details like punctuality, quality of workmanship, and overall customer satisfaction.
Personal referrals are just as valuable. Ask friends, family, or neighbors if they know a trustworthy electrician. Word-of-mouth recommendations often lead you to established professionals.
Compare Quotes, But Don’t Go Only for the Lowest Price
Always request multiple quotes to gauge the average cost for your project. However, avoid choosing solely based on the cheapest option. A significantly low estimate may signal:
- Use of inferior materials
- Insufficient insurance coverage
- Compromised workmanship
Look for transparent pricing and itemized quotes that outline material costs, labor, and potential extra fees. Your goal is to balance fair pricing with high-quality service.
Evaluate Communication and Professionalism
A reputable local electrician will be responsive, punctual, and open to discussing the details of the job. If they respond quickly to calls or emails, provide a clear breakdown of the tasks, and arrive on time for consultations or scheduled appointments, it’s a good sign of their professionalism and customer service.
Check for Guarantees and Warranties
Many dependable electricians in Peterborough offer guarantees on their workmanship and may provide warranties on the parts or fixtures they install. This demonstrates confidence in their work; they’re more likely to address any post-installation issues promptly and at no extra charge.
Keep Local Regulations in Mind
Peterborough, like other municipalities, has building codes and regulations that must be followed. Ensure your local electrician is knowledgeable about all required permits, inspections, and code requirements. This will prevent legal complications and unexpected costs down the line.
